What Are the Most Common Signs Your Home Needs Rewiring?

Many homeowners don’t realize their wiring is outdated until electrical problems become impossible to ignore. While an occasional tripped breaker isn’t unusual, recurring issues throughout the home often point to a larger problem hidden behind the walls.

Frequent breaker trips, flickering or dimming lights, buzzing switches, warm outlets, or burning odors should never be dismissed as normal. These symptoms can indicate deteriorating wiring, loose electrical connections, overloaded circuits, or an electrical panel that can no longer safely handle your home’s power demands.

Older homes may also contain wiring systems that were installed long before today’s appliances, electronics, and smart home technology became standard. Even if the wiring has functioned for years, it may no longer provide the level of safety or capacity your household requires.

Why Does Old Wiring Become a Safety Concern?

Electrical wiring naturally ages over time. Insulation can become brittle, connections may loosen, and decades of use place stress on the entire electrical system. As homeowners add larger televisions, computers, kitchen appliances, HVAC equipment, electric vehicle chargers, and home office technology, older wiring often struggles to support the increased electrical load.

Some homes still contain aluminum wiring or knob-and-tube wiring. While these systems were commonly installed during their respective eras, they were never designed for the electrical demands of modern living. Older wiring doesn’t automatically mean your home is unsafe, but it does warrant a professional inspection to determine whether repairs or upgrades are recommended.

One of the most concerning warning signs is a burning smell, visible scorch marks around outlets, or outlets and switches that feel warm to the touch. These conditions should be evaluated immediately, as they may indicate overheating electrical connections.

How do I know if my house needs to be rewired?

Common warning signs include frequently tripped breakers, flickering lights, buzzing outlets or switches, burning odors, warm outlets, and outdated wiring systems. A professional inspection is the best way to determine whether rewiring is necessary.

Is old wiring always unsafe?

Not necessarily. Some older wiring systems continue to function safely when properly maintained. However, aging wiring should be inspected periodically to ensure it remains in good condition and can safely support your home's electrical needs.

Should I upgrade my electrical panel at the same time?

Many older homes benefit from both services. If your current panel no longer provides enough capacity or doesn't meet modern safety standards, upgrading it during a rewiring project is often the most practical solution.

Does rewiring increase home value?

Updated electrical systems can improve safety, support modern appliances and technology, and make a home more appealing to future buyers while reducing the likelihood of electrical issues.
